Luggage and bags: Always bring some big zip lock bags for packing your wet stuff in and for keeping your dry stuff dry. Remember that there is a rainy season here from October to December and things do get wet in the suitcases.
Clothing/Shoes/Weather Gear: Shorts and sandals and if you are there during the rainy season the bring some wet weather gear or a poncho.
Toiletries and Medical Supplies: When traveling around anyplace that has mosquitoes and other biting insects like sand flies it is best to arm yourself to the teeth with bug guards of some sort.
Skin so Soft is sold by Avon and works real well to keep the little buggers from biting you and Cactus Juice works as well.
Cactus Juice can be purchased online at www.cactusjuicetm.com or you can find it on the island in the local shops.
Photo Equipment: Bring a good underwater camera for those underwater shots and a good digital camera for the sunsets.
Camping/Beach/Outdoor Gear: Most hotels here will let you take the towles to the beach but you may want to bring a nice big one.
Miscellaneous: Cactus Juice also sells an “after the fact” cream that will take the itch away and sooth the sunburn as well
